How to grow Cauliflower 'White Cloud'

  • Full Sun

  • Medium

Try to plant in a location that enjoys full sun and remember to water moderately. Keep in mind when planting that White Cloud is thought of as hardy, so this plant will grow or become dormant during the winter. A soil ph of between 6.5 and 7.0 is ideal for White Cloud as it does best in weakly acidic soil - neutral soil.

Growing White Cloud from seed

Sow at a depth of approx. 0.58 inches (1.5 cm) and aim for a distance of at least 3.12 inches (8.0 cm) between Cauliflower plants. Soil temperature should be kept higher than 24°C / 75°F to ensure good germination.

By our calculations, you should look at sowing White Cloud about 14 days before your last frost date.

Transplanting White Cloud

10 to 12 weeks to maturity.

As White Cloud is hardy, ensure temperatures are mild enough to plant out - wait until after your last frost date to be on the safe side.

Harvesting White Cloud

This variety tends to be ready for harvesting by late winter.
